How much does it cost to rent a home in Pearland?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pearland 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,480 | $1,200 | $1,900 |
| Pearland 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,147 | $800 | $5,800 |
| Pearland 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,657 | $1,700 | $5,000 |
| Pearland 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,541 | $2,195 | $5,300 |
| Pearland 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,580 | $3,580 | $3,580 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pearland
What type of rentals are currently available in Pearland?
There are currently 105 Apartments for Rent in Pearland, TX with pricing that ranges from $509 to $13,181. There are also 376 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Pearland ranging from $750 to $5,800.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Pearland?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Pearland ranges from $750 to $5,800 with an average monthly rent of $2,409.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Pearland?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Pearland range from $692 to $6,494,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$800 to $5,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,700 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,275.
